Arcadia Bluffs - The South Course
FairwayIQ: 82 | 18 holes | Public | $185 | Google: 4.6★
The South Course at Arcadia Bluffs represents championship golf at its finest. This spectacular layout hugs the Lake Michigan bluffs, delivering breathtaking views on nearly every hole. The course features championship-caliber Raynor greens that demand precision and local knowledge to master.
What sets the South Course apart is its combination of natural beauty and strategic design. The routing takes full advantage of the dramatic elevation changes, creating memorable holes that test every aspect of your game. The resort amenities are top-notch, making this an ideal centerpiece for a northern Michigan golf trip. At $185, it's a premium experience that delivers on its promise.

Grandview Golf Club
FairwayIQ: 79 | 18 holes | Semi-private | $25 | Google: 4.6★
Grandview Golf Club in Kalkaska represents exceptional value in northern Michigan golf. This traditional layout features fast greens and pristine bunkers that create an authentic golf experience at a fraction of the cost you'd expect for this quality.
The course design emphasizes strategy over length, rewarding course management and precision over pure power. The maintenance standards are impressive for a $25 green fee, with conditions that rival courses charging three times as much. The semi-private status means you'll want to call ahead, but it's worth the effort for this level of value.

Crystal Downs Country Club
FairwayIQ: 78 | 18 holes | Private | Google: 4.7★
Crystal Downs Country Club in Frankfort represents classic golf architecture at its finest. This strategic design emphasizes course management and shot-making over distance, with exceptional views that complement the old-school country club atmosphere.
As a private club, access requires connections or reciprocal privileges, but the experience delivers classic golf in its purest form. The design rewards thoughtful play and punishes poor decisions, creating the kind of golf that builds character and keeps you coming back.
